Pursuant to the New York State Freedom of Information Law (1977 N.Y. Laws ch. 933), I hereby request the following records:

This is a request for the most current copy of all New York City Council Staff by Assignment, including their emails, phone numbers, and any other contact information available in xls or csv format (in the past we either have not received any email addresses or have been redirected to the New York City Council’s website, but it is critical that we have email addresses in a spreadsheet in the same format as the other information). This letter serves as a response to your Freedom of Information Law (FOIL) request you sent to this office on the above date. I have attached responsive documents to your request. Please be advised that the central telephone number for the New York City Council is (212) 788- 7210 and the mailing address for all staff is: 250 Broadway New York, New York 10007. I will direct you to the New York City Council's website for the mailing addresses for all Council Member office staff assigned to Council district offices https://council.nyc.gov/.

Please be advised the portion of your request asking for a list of all e-mail addresses for all New York City Council staff is denied pursuant to §87(2) (i) of the Freedom of Information Law. Under §87 (2)(i) agencies can withhold information where the release of the information would jeopardize an agency's capacity to guarantee the security of its information. If you have any questions or concerns about this, please contact me. If you wish to appeal this decision, you may do so, in writing, within thirty days to Patrick Bradford, FOIL Appeals Officer, at 250 Broadway, 15th Floor, New York, New York 10007 or pbradford@council.nyc.gov<mailto:pbradford@council.nyc.gov>.
